Cannabis is grown from one of 2 sources: a seed or a clone. Seeds carry genetic info from two moms and dad plants and can express several combinations of characteristics: some from the mother, some from the daddy, and some qualities from both. In commercial marijuana production, generally, growers will plant numerous seeds of one pressure and choose the very best plant. They will then take clones from that private plant, which allows for consistent genetics for mass production. autoflowering marijuana seeds. Growing from seed can produce a more powerful plant with more strong genes. Plants grown from seed can be more hearty as young plants when compared to clones, mainly due to the fact that seeds have a strong taproot. You can plant seeds straight into an outdoor garden in early spring, even in cool, wet climates. If growing outside, some growers choose to sprout seeds inside because they are fragile in the starting stages of growth. Inside your home, you can offer weed seedlings additional light to help them along, and after that transplant them outside when big enough. You can also decrease headaches and prevent the trouble of seed germination and sexing plants by starting with clones.
A clone is a cutting that is genetically similar to the plant it was taken fromthat plant is understood as the "mom." Through cloning, you can develop a brand-new harvest with specific reproductions of your favorite plant. Since genes equal, a clone will provide you a plant with the same characteristics as the mother, such as flavor, cannabinoid profile, yield, grow time, etc. So if you come across a specific strain or phenotype you truly like, you may wish to clone it to recreate more buds that have the exact same effects and qualities. Another disadvantage to clones is they can take on negative qualities from the mother plant also. If the mother has a disease, attracts insects, or grows weak branches, its clones will probably have the very same problems. Feminized marijuana seeds will produce just female plants for getting buds, so there is no requirement to remove males or fret about female plants getting pollinated. Feminized seeds are produced by causing the monoecious condition in a female cannabis plantthe resulting seeds are nearly similar to the self-pollinated female parent, as just one set of genes is present.

They are easy to grow because you do not need to fret about light cycles and how much light a plant receives. Many cannabis plants begin blooming when the amount of light they get daily reduces. Outdoors, this takes place when the sun starts setting previously in the day as the season turns from summer to fall. Indoor growers can control when a plant flowers by minimizing the everyday quantity of light plants get from 18 hours to 12 hours - autoflowering seeds.
Autoflowers can be started in early spring and will flower during the longest days of summer, making the most of high quality light to get bigger yields. Or, if you get a late start in the growing season, you can start autoflowers in May or June and harvest in the fall (feminized cannabis seeds). Likewise, autoflower plants are smallperfect for closet grows or any small grow, or growing outdoors where you don't desire your neighbors to see what you're up to. A couple big drawbacks, though: Autoflower pressures are understood for being less potent. Also, because they are small in stature, they typically do not produce huge yields.

CBD, or cannabidiol, is among the chemical componentsknown jointly as cannabinoidsfound in the cannabis plant. Throughout the years, people have actually picked plants for high-THC content, making cannabis with high levels of CBD unusual. The genetic paths through which THC is synthesized by the plant are various than those for CBD production. Cannabis utilized for hemp production has been chosen for other qualities, including a low THC content, so as to comply with the 2018 Farm Expense.
As interest in CBD as a medicine has grown, numerous breeders have actually crossed high-CBD hemp with marijuana. These stress have little or no THC, 1:1 ratios of THC and CBD, or some have a high-THC material along with significant quantities of CBD (3% or more). Cannabis seeds need three things to germinate: water, heat, and air. There are numerous methods to germinate seeds, but for the most typical and simplest technique, you will require: Two tidy plates, Four paper towels, Seeds, Pure water Take 4 sheets of paper towels and soak them with pure water. The towels must be soaked however should not have excess water running off.
Then, put the marijuana seeds a minimum of an inch apart from each other and cover them with the remaining 2 water-soaked paper towels. To create a dark, protected area, take another plate and turn it over to cover the seeds, like a dome. Make sure the location the seeds are in is warm, somewhere in between 70-85F. After completing these steps, it's time to wait. Check the paper towels once a day to make sure they're still saturated, and if they are losing wetness, use more water to keep the seeds pleased - cheap autoflowering seeds. Some seeds sprout really rapidly while others can take a while, but typically, seeds need to germinate in 3-10 days.
A seed has actually germinated when the seed divides and a single sprout appears. The sprout is the taproot, which will end up being the primary stem of the plant, and seeing it signifies effective germination. It's essential to keep the delicate seed sterile, so do not touch the seed or taproot as it starts to split.
